Habitat et Humanisme, a modern and contemporary environment

Target

Habitat et Humanisme wanted to change its old offices, which had deteriorated and no longer met its spatial and working methodology needs, for others adapted to a much more dynamic and modern spirit.

A place with individual work spaces and areas for exchange, where the meeting between teams and with the beneficiaries of the programmes is fundamental.

Solution

For its new offices in Paris, Habitat et Humanisme Île-de-France has chosen an empty space, which it has completely renovated, both in terms of flooring, carpentry, painting, partitions and insulation, as well as a layout that alternates informal meeting spaces, coworking areas and a flexible openspace, with individual bubbles and offices that can also function as small meeting rooms.The layout alternates informal meeting spaces, coworking areas and a flexible openspace, with individual bubbles and offices that can also function as small meeting rooms.

With a spatial layout that favours brightness and fluid circulation, the project prioritises light colours and contemporary materials to give a dynamic and modern image, reflecting the association's trajectory. An agile and fresh environment, in which Actiu participates with flexible furniture adapted to new uses, respectful of the environment, which prioritises wellbeing and promotes flexibility.

The result is offices that encourage exchange and collaboration, where the Habitat et Humanisme team benefits from greater comfort and a better quality of life. An environment that allows many different ways of meeting and working, both in an open-space equipped with Vital Pro tables, Stay chairs and modular storage cabinets, and in more enclosed rooms, which alternate the same Stay chairs with other Noom 50 chairs and Vital Pro and Prisma tables.

To favour postural change and movement, the offices are filled with programmes such as Longo, Bend or Grada from the Agile collection, which keep the space connected and offer a wide variety of working environments; and others, such as the high Tabula tables, the folding and mobile Talent tables or the Whass stools, which favour improvised meetings and individual work.
